Starvation is due to lack of food, inability or lack of desire to eat.

Gross

  • Serous fat atrophy:[1]
    • Soft brown/myxoid material replaces fat.

Microscopic

Features:

  • Globular cells 3-4x a RBC with:
    • Clear cytoplasm.
    • One small peripheral nucleus.

Associations[1]

  • Acute febrile states.
  • AIDS.
  • Alcoholism.
  • Anorexia nervosa.
  • Cachexia.
  • Carcinomas.
  • Chronic heart failure.
  • Lymphoma.
